Output 9bc25ca5824d66bbfd92f8c25d59529e4987efd12fbef8f4a9e80597fc01a52a:25

value
341085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ae0db384e07923edb998297b1c78153432581f00 OP_EQUAL
address
3HZKuuEzfAb7ERgL9Ams8a6HCtQsAwR6dn
transaction
9bc25ca5824d66bbfd92f8c25d59529e4987efd12fbef8f4a9e80597fc01a52a
spent
true